How do I get to the answer? (3 x n) + 4 = 32/2 What is the value of n?

If you simplify what's in the bracket, you get 3n

=(3n)+4=32/2
=3n+4= 32/2(here we can either crossmultiply or equate)
3n+4-4=32/2-4(subtract 4 from both sides)
3n=32/2-4
3n=24/2
3n=12
3n=12(divide both sides by the coefficient of the unknown)
3n/3=12/3
n=4
